Watching Silver ($SI) at this 19.50 level
Been keeping a close eye on silver today, specifically the action around that 19.50 mark. We saw a pretty swift drop, pushing down towards the day's low, and it felt like there was a bit of a scramble to defend that level. It bounced fairly decently off of it, currently sitting around 19.92.
My take right now is that 19.50 acts as a pretty significant support. If we see a clean break and sustained trade below that — say, a close under 19.45 on the daily — then I'd start to reconsider the short-term bullish case for silver. That would invalidate this bounce for me and suggest we could see further downside pressure. Conversely, if it holds and we start to build a base around here, maybe even get a push towards the 20.70 high again, it could signal some renewed strength.
